The human body is not a biological masterpiece. Many people who aren't trans need hormones to keep them stable, or need other medications to treat things that are different in their body too. Would you tell someone with PCOS or thyroid disease to not take hormones because the body "knows what it is doing"? Then why do you care so much about it when it comes to people's gender? Literally how does people being trans bother you? People just want to exist in peace.

Not everyone can afford to immigrate to a palace that aligns with their personal values. For example, an American who lives in a trailer park and works two minimum wage jobs won't be able to move to say, Norway. They're still allowed to complain about the failings of America, and as a working class person, they're allowed to be mad that the one "low income" job would take far better care of them in another country. If people can't see what's wrong in their home country and want to improve it then that's an issue. America isn't perfect, but with people of different walks of life and different backgrounds putting their heads together, I'm sure they could create something much more liveable than what they have now. Wanting things to change and improve isn't "disliking" the country they're in, but loving it enough to want it to change for the better.

Exactly! A lot of the understanding people have about how climate change affects animals in the polar regions tends to be centered around them losing ice- which is horrible. But the biggest killer is unstable seasons, and early rains with warm winters. It traps all the food under thick layers of ice and causes mass starvation. Unfortunately, some of the herds in Siberia have died off in the tens of thousands due to this issue and I'm really hoping that more awareness about this can help somehow.
